Denied

The Veteran is not entitled to Chapter 30 educational assistance benefits for his period of on-the-job peace officer training with the California Highway Patrol from May 27, 2002 to May 27, 2003.

The deciding factor: The commencing date of the award of educational assistance is after the Veteran concluded the program on May 27, 2003, based on the applicable regulations.
